Visitation Day came and went and Goliath still had not seen any of his clan in what felt like, and might have been, years. He still had not seen Elisa since she was nearly killed in his sleep, then vanished angry at him. There had been several times like these before, when the gathering of new crew members has been too painful for him to attend, knowing that his clan would come from elsewhere and at other times, and so podpops offered him only one chance at reunion with a loved one.
Disappointment had settled on him again, and he warded it off with productiveness. Elisa's car shone with the evidence of regular care, but the rest of the castle needed maintaining. He would invite more people in to work in the gardens, dispose of more of Xanatos' things - but first, he felt there was more still to gain by researching the Mayan sun amulet that he hoped could give him control over his waking and sleeping. It would be a good idea to contact Lupin again, but at the moment, it it pleased Goliath to conduct his research in solitude.
Deep in his reading in Castle Wyvern's library, he didn't hear footsteps until the door had already been opened behind him.
